Florida Penalties for DUI First Conviction
- Fine - $250 to $500
- Community Service - 50 Hours
- Probation - Not more than 1 Year
- Imprisonment - Not more than 6 Months
- Imprisonment with BAL of .08 or higher with a minor in the vehicle, not more than 9 months
- License Revocation - Minimum of 180 days
- DUI School - 12 Hours
